Last month, I had the awesome opportunity to speak at the Gate City Naturals January Lunch 'n Learn.  This free event was held at EM Creative Fitness and Wellness in Greensboro on a cool Saturday.  When I arrived at the event, I was surprised to find that the fitness center has a juice bar as soon as you walk in.  They were in the midst of making juices and smoothies for customers.





As I walked further inside, I walked in the work out area where the lunch 'n learn would take place.  As the event got started, naturalistas (and gentlemen) came in and fixed a plate with a light lunch and sat down.



The creator of Gate City Naturals, Teasha, welcomed everyone and after her welcome, I stepped up to talk about natural hair and more.  I started the lunch conversation with sharing my own natural hair story.  From there, I shared how I got started with the blog and how originally it was solely a beauty blog.



I answered questions that people had regarding natural hair and beauty.  I also gave away to prizes.  I gave a prize away to the youngest natural in the group and who could remember how long I have been natural.  I had an awesome time at the event and met a lot of beautiful women inside and out.
